What is the Emoluments Clause? And how might it apply to Qatar giving Trump a plane?
President Donald Trump's readiness to accept a luxury jet as a gift from the ruling family of Qatar for conversion into a presidential aircraft has revived the conversations around emoluments and the notion of a president otherwise allegedly profiting off of the office.

But there are constitutional prohibitions against the president receiving gifts from foreign entities or even domestic ones. It's a conversation over emoluments, territory that Trump has been forced to navigate, and litigate, in the past.
What is an emolument?
Simply, an emolument is compensation for services, from employment or holding office, that can take the form of a salary, fee or profit.
What is the Emoluments Clause?
There are separate emoluments delineations in the U.S. Constitution. Both are aimed at preserving the independence of the president from influence from outside entities, including Congress, states and foreign governments.
Article I bars anyone holding government office from accepting any present, emolument, office or title from any 바카라 게임 웹사이트King, Prince, or foreign State,바카라 게임 웹사이트 without congressional consent.
Article II deals with domestic emoluments, noting that Congress can't increase or decrease the president's compensation during his term in office, and prohibits the president from receiving any emolument from the states.
Why is the Emoluments Clause coming up now?
Trump has reportedly been offered a Boeing 747-8 by Qatar in an arrangement that could be formalized as he travels to the Middle East this week. The Qatari government has said a final decision hasn't been made. But Trump has defended the idea as a fiscally smart move for the country, even as critics argue it would amount to a president accepting an astonishingly valuable gift from a foreign government.

There are other Trump-related deals with Qatar. Last month, the Trump family company struck a deal to build a luxury golf resort there, in a sign it has no plans to hold back from foreign dealmaking during a second Trump administration.
The project, which features Trump-branded beachside villas and an 18-hole golf course to be built by a Saudi Arabian company, marked the first foreign deal by the Trump Organization since Trump resumed office.
Has Trump dealt with debate over emoluments before?
In his first term, Trump faced lawsuits from Maryland and the District of Columbia, as well as high-end restaurants and hotels in New York and Washington, D.C., that accused him of illegally profiting off the presidency through his luxury Washington hotel.
In 2021, the U.S. Supreme Court brought an end to the cases, ruling them as moot since Trump was no longer president. Has Congress weighed in on emoluments?
They've tried.
Last year, congressional Democrats introduced legislation that would prohibit U.S. officials from accepting money, payments or gifts from foreign governments without congressional consent. It was their response to a yearslong probe into Trump's overseas business dealings.
The proposals led by Rep. Jamie Raskin and Sen. Richard Blumenthal would enforce the Constitution바카라 게임 웹사이트s ban on emoluments, which prohibits the president from accepting foreign gifts and money without Congress바카라 게임 웹사이트 permission. Democrats have argued that Trump ignored the clause as president.
Neither bill advanced.
